How to Make Ground Beef Taco Cabbage Skillet Step by Step
Ingredients
1 pound lean ground beef
5 cups green cabbage, shredded or chopped
1/4 cup low carb taco seasoning
1 Tbsp dry minced onion
1/4 cup water
1 1/2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
Directions
- In a large skillet over medium heat, cook the ground beef until browned. Drain excess fat.
- Add the shredded cabbage and taco seasoning to the skillet, stirring to combine.
- Pour in the water and add the dry minced onion.
- Cover the skillet and let it cook until the cabbage is tender, about 10 minutes.
- Remove the lid, stir in the cheddar cheese, and cook just until melted. Serve hot.

How to Store Ground Beef Taco Cabbage Skillet
Leftover Ground Beef Taco Cabbage Skillet can be stored in the fridge for up to three days. Ensure itโs kept in an airtight container. When youโre ready to enjoy it again, simply reheat it in a skillet over medium heat until warmed through. This dish can also be frozen for up to three months; just make sure to use a freezer-safe container. Reheating from frozen can be done in the microwave or by thawing in the fridge overnight, then warming on the stovetop.
Expert Tips for Cooking Ground Beef Taco Cabbage Skillet
- For added flavor, sautรฉ the minced onion with the ground beef before adding other ingredients.
- Feel free to add black beans or corn for extra texture and taste.
- Adjust the taco seasoning to your preferenceโadd more for extra kick or use a mild blend for a milder flavor.
- Experiment with different types of cheese, like pepper jack, for a spicy twist.
- Garnish with diced tomatoes or green onions for an extra fresh element.
Delicious Variations of Ground Beef Taco Cabbage Skillet
- Spicy version: Add chopped jalapeรฑos or a sprinkle of cayenne pepper for heat.
- Herbed version: Mix in fresh herbs like cilantro or parsley to brighten up the dishโs flavor.
- Vegetarian option: Substitute the ground beef with crumbled tofu or white beans for a plant-based meal.
